A business service encapsulation and access system, method and device for a rich client

A technology for business services and rich clients, which is applied in the field of business service encapsulation and access devices for rich clients, and can solve the problems of difficult access and difficult interface access methods for clients.

Active Publication Date: 2021-12-10
北京数立得科技有限公司
View PDF8 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

In particular, for a large number of legacy Windows applications, since the client is a closed executable program, its business data service faces the following two challenges: 1) Business data is only presented on the client interface, and it is difficult to programmatically obtain it from the client
2) Although the server may have a programmatic access interface to the business data in the data source, it is difficult to directly obtain the access method of the interface from the client

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• A business service encapsulation and access system, method and device for a rich client
  • A business service encapsulation and access system, method and device for a rich client
  • A business service encapsulation and access system, method and device for a rich client

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0059] Such as image 3 As shown in the figure, it shows a schematic diagram of the composition of a business service encapsulation and access system of a rich client in the present invention, including an interoperable system, and the interoperable system includes a data interface generation platform and a data interface operation platform, wherein:

[0060] The data interface generation platform also includes:

[0061] User-driven recording module for recording user operations;

[0062] A user-driven operation arrangement module, configured to arrange the recorded operations;

[0063] The system driver monitoring module is used to record the client's call request for data;

[0064] The system-driven orchestration module is used to assist developers to quickly locate one or several consecutive requests;

[0065] Application-driven decompilation tool for decompiling the client;

[0066] An application-driven instrumentation tool, which enables the client to record the data...

Embodiment 2

[0078] Such as Figure 4 As shown in FIG. 1 , it shows a flow chart of the steps of a business service encapsulation and access method for a rich client in the present invention. The method is applied to the system described in Embodiment 1 of the present invention. The method may include the following steps:

[0079] Step S401: using the client as a "black box", and using a user-driven service method and a system-driven service method to process the "black box" respectively, so as to realize business data service;

[0080] Step S402: When the "black box" cannot extract the target business data, use the client as a "gray box" and use the application-driven service method to process the "gray box" to realize the service of business data .

[0081] The embodiment of this application starts with the architecture and implementation technology of Windows applications, designs and implements a business data service framework for legacy Windows applications, regards the client as a ...

Embodiment 3

[0182] Such as Image 6 As shown, based on the same inventive concept, corresponding to the method in Embodiment 2 of the present invention, it shows a structural block diagram of a business service encapsulation and access device for a rich client in the present invention, and the device is applied to the method described in Embodiment 1 of the present invention system, the device includes the following modules:

[0183] The black box service processing module 601 is used to use the client as a "black box", and use the user-driven service method and the system-driven service method to process the "black box" respectively, so as to realize the service of business data;

[0184] The gray box service processing module 602 is used to use the client as a "gray box" when the "black box" cannot extract the target business data, and use the application-driven service method to process the "gray box" processing to realize service-oriented business data.

[0185] Corresponding to the...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ses a business service encapsulation and access system, method and device of a rich client. The invention regards the client as a "black box" and uses a user-driven service method and a system-driven service method to control the "black box". "box" to process business data as a service; when the "black box" cannot extract the target business data, use the client as a "gray box" and use the application-driven service method to process the "gray box" ” to process and realize business data service, so as to overcome the challenge that existing business data cannot be serviced in the C / S architecture.

Description

technical field [0001] The present invention relates to computer information technology, in particular to a business service encapsulation and access system for a rich client, a business service encapsulation and access method for a rich client, and a business service encapsulation and access device for a rich client. Background technique [0002] In recent years, the rapid development of new network platforms such as the Internet and its extensions such as the mobile Internet and the Internet of Things has made information systems, users, and the physical world merge with each other, providing conditions and requirements for data opening and sharing. At the same time, cloud computing makes computing resources easy to obtain and use, and provides favorable conditions for data analysis and mining. The openness and sharing of data enables data to be accessed from other systems outside the system through other means. Multiple systems connecting to the same data source not only...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(China)
IPC IPC(8): H04L29/06H04L29/08
CPCH04L69/22H04L67/025H04L67/34H04L67/01H04L67/60
Inventor 张舒汇贺赞贤易超
Owner 北京数立得科技有限公司
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products